<?php
|
|
declare(strict_types=1);
|
|
|
|
namespace Lcobucci\JWT\Validation\Constraint;
|
|
|
|
use DateInterval;
|
|
use DateTimeInterface;
|
|
use Lcobucci\Clock\Clock;
|
|
use Lcobucci\JWT\Token;
|
|
use Lcobucci\JWT\Validation\ConstraintViolation;
|
|
use Lcobucci\JWT\Validation\ValidAt as ValidAtInterface;
|
|
|
|
final class LooseValidAt implements ValidAtInterface
|
|
{
|
|
private Clock $clock;
|
|
private DateInterval $leeway;
|
|
|
|
public function __construct(Clock $clock, ?DateInterval $leeway = null)
|
|
{
|
|
$this->clock = $clock;
|
|
$this->leeway = $this->guardLeeway($leeway);
|
|
}
|
|
|
|
private function guardLeeway(?DateInterval $leeway): DateInterval
|
|
{
|
|
if ($leeway === null) {
|
|
return new DateInterval('PT0S');
|
|
}
|
|
|
|
if ($leeway->invert === 1) {
|
|
throw LeewayCannotBeNegative::create();
|
|
}
|
|
|
|
return $leeway;
|
|
}
|
|
|
|
public function assert(Token $token): void
|
|
{
|
|
$now = $this->clock->now();
|
|
|
|
$this->assertIssueTime($token, $now->add($this->leeway));
|
|
$this->assertMinimumTime($token, $now->add($this->leeway));
|
|
$this->assertExpiration($token, $now->sub($this->leeway));
|
|
}
|
|
|
|
/** @throws ConstraintViolation */
|
|
private function assertExpiration(Token $token, DateTimeInterface $now): void
|
|
{
|
|
if ($token->isExpired($now)) {
|
|
throw ConstraintViolation::error('The token is expired', $this);
|
|
}
|
|
}
|
|
|
|
/** @throws ConstraintViolation */
|
|
private function assertMinimumTime(Token $token, DateTimeInterface $now): void
|
|
{
|
|
if (! $token->isMinimumTimeBefore($now)) {
|
|
throw ConstraintViolation::error('The token cannot be used yet', $this);
|
|
}
|
|
}
|
|
|
|
/** @throws ConstraintViolation */
|
|
private function assertIssueTime(Token $token, DateTimeInterface $now): void
|
|
{
|
|
if (! $token->hasBeenIssuedBefore($now)) {
|
|
throw ConstraintViolation::error('The token was issued in the future', $this);
|
|
}
|
|
}
|
|
}
